10 Facts About Bill Dundee

1.

Bill Dundee was born in Angus, Scotland, and raised in Melbourne.

2.

Bill Dundee started wrestling in Australia in 1962 and finally arrived in the United States as "Superstar" Bill Dundee in 1974 with his tag team partner George Barnes.

3.

Bill Dundee made a name for himself in the Memphis Territory, where he regularly teamed and feuded with Jerry Lawler and Jimmy Valiant for years.

4.

Bill Dundee had a brief run in the NWA's Jim Crockett Promotions, Central States Wrestling and Florida Championship Wrestling in 1986, where he teamed with Jimmy Garvin and feuded with Sam Houston for the NWA Central States Heavyweight Championship.

5.

Bill Dundee briefly managed The Barbarian and The MOD Squad while in those territories.

6.

Bill Dundee had a run in World Championship Wrestling in the early 1990s as Sir William, the manager for Lord Steven Regal.

7.

Bill Dundee worked as a booker for Memphis, Louisiana and Georgia.

8.

Bill Dundee is still active as of 2019 in Memphis Wrestling, where he has been a heel and a baby face.

9.

Bill Dundee frequently appears on Jackson, Tennessee, talk radio station WNWS 101.5 with Dan Reeves and on a talk show on Public-access television cable TV channels in West Tennessee.

10.

Bill Dundee still promotes indy cards across Tennessee and in Southaven, Mississippi.
